The celestial curtains have officially closed on Prime Video’s fantasy series. Following a turbulent development cycle severely impacted by allegations against creator Neil Gaiman, the third season of Good Omens was drastically retooled. Instead of a full six episode run, the studio opted to wrap up Aziraphale and Crowley's beloved saga with a single, fast paced ninety minute special. This final episode premiered on May 13, 2026, marking the definitive end of the line for the franchise.

While Michael Sheen and David Tennant delivered their usual undeniable chemistry, the rushed pacing left dedicated viewers with mixed emotions. Critics and fans alike noted the messy execution of the heavily condensed narrative. With the series now permanently concluded, the heavenly and hellish factions will finally rest in peace.

Adapted from the beloved novel by Neil Gaiman and Terry Pratchett, Good Omens redefined high-concept fantasy on streaming. The series centers on the unlikely partnership between the angel Aziraphale and the demon Crowley, portrayed with undeniable chemistry by Michael Sheen and David Tennant. Beyond its celestial stakes and witty dialogue, the show secured a permanent place in television history through its exploration of human nature and moral ambiguity. Its production design and eccentric humor honored Pratchett’s singular voice while expanding the source material into a multi-season epic. By blending theological satire with a deeply moving central relationship, Good Omens fostered a dedicated global community. It remains a definitive example of how to translate complex, literary world-building into a successful, modern television phenomenon that resonates across generations.

Good Omens will not be returning for a fourth season, as the series officially concluded with its third installment [1.4.1]. The final season was condensed into a single 90-minute episode that premiered on May 13, 2026. Amazon Prime Video confirmed this feature-length special serves as the definitive ending for the franchise.

Production for the third and final season is completely finished. The highly anticipated conclusion was released globally on Amazon Prime Video on May 13, 2026. Viewers can now stream the 90-minute series finale in its entirety.

The initial four-year gap between the first two seasons occurred because creators had to write entirely new material beyond the original 1990 novel. The wait for the third season was further extended by the 2023 Hollywood strikes and a subsequent production pause in 2024. This pause ultimately led to the final season being restructured into a single 90-minute special.

There are currently no canonical spin-offs in development for the Good Omens universe. The recent 90-minute finale was specifically designed to permanently conclude the overarching story and character arcs. Amazon MGM Studios has not announced any plans to expand the franchise further.

The final season was reduced to a single 90-minute episode following the departure of series creator Neil Gaiman in 2024 amid controversy. Amazon paused production and restructured the planned six-episode arc to quickly wrap up the story. This allowed the studio to provide a definitive ending for fans while navigating the behind-the-scenes complications.
